Chapter 2 the method of multipliers for equality constrained problems . 2. necessary conditions for constrained local maximum and minimum the basic necessary condition for a constrained local maximum is provided by la grange’s theorem. The points x at which the constraint quali cation fails (i.e., rank dg(x ) < m) should be considered separately since the lagrange theorem is not applicable to them. With an introduction to constraints out of the way, we are ready to talk about constrained optimization. recall that in these situations, we are trying to optimize some objective function subject to one or more constraints. these constraints may not even be binding, so they must be checked.
